Question:
Why do Randall sheaths have the retaining strap coming over the sharp edge of knife rather than over the blunt spine were it won't get cut when drawing in/out?
Am I missing something?
I guess there is logic, just can't figure it..

The quick answer is RMK doesn't have the room for more sheaths , the knives that are primarily double hilts, the sheaths have the strap coming from front to back and the other knives have sheaths that the strap comes back to front to handle both double and single hilt knives.
